首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

android studio自动关闭

基础概念

Android Studio 是 Google 官方推出的用于 Android 应用开发的集成开发环境(IDE)。它基于 IntelliJ IDEA 进行开发,提供了丰富的功能和工具,帮助开发者高效地构建、测试和发布 Android 应用。

自动关闭的原因

Android Studio 自动关闭可能有多种原因,包括但不限于:

  1. 内存不足:如果系统内存不足,Android Studio 可能会因为无法分配足够的内存而崩溃。
  2. 插件冲突:某些第三方插件可能与 Android Studio 不兼容,导致自动关闭。
  3. 系统问题:操作系统本身的问题,如系统更新、驱动程序问题等,也可能导致 Android Studio 自动关闭。
  4. 软件bug:Android Studio 本身可能存在 bug,导致自动关闭。

解决方法

1. 检查内存设置

确保你的系统有足够的内存供 Android Studio 使用。可以通过以下步骤增加 Android Studio 的内存分配:

  • 打开 bin 目录下的 studio.vmoptions 文件(Windows)或 studio.vmoptions 文件(Mac/Linux)。
  • 修改以下参数:
  • 修改以下参数:
  • 根据你的系统内存情况,适当调整这些值。

2. 禁用插件

禁用所有第三方插件,然后逐个启用,以确定是否有插件导致问题。

  • 打开 Android Studio,进入 File -> Settings(Windows/Linux)或 Android Studio -> Preferences(Mac)。
  • 选择 Plugins,禁用所有第三方插件,重启 Android Studio,观察是否还会自动关闭。

3. 更新系统和驱动程序

确保你的操作系统和所有相关驱动程序都是最新的。

  • Windows:进入 Settings -> Update & Security -> Windows Update,检查更新。
  • Mac:打开 App Store,检查系统更新。
  • Linux:使用包管理器更新系统和驱动程序。

4. 检查日志文件

查看 Android Studio 的日志文件,以获取更多关于崩溃的信息。

  • 打开 Help -> Show Log in Explorer(Windows)或 Help -> Show Log in Finder(Mac)。
  • 查看 idea.log 文件,寻找错误信息和堆栈跟踪。

5. 重新安装 Android Studio

如果以上方法都无法解决问题,可以尝试重新安装 Android Studio。

  • 卸载当前的 Android Studio。
  • 删除 ~/.AndroidStudioX.X 目录(Windows/Linux)或 ~/Library/Preferences/AndroidStudioX.X 目录(Mac)。
  • 从官方网站下载最新版本的 Android Studio 并重新安装。

参考链接

通过以上方法,你应该能够解决 Android Studio 自动关闭的问题。如果问题依然存在,建议在相关社区或论坛寻求帮助,并提供详细的日志信息以便他人诊断。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Android Studio自动提取控件Style样式教程

    如题,有时候看见一个布局写上几百行看上去会非常吃力麻烦,这时候抽取控件样式很有必要了, Android Studio提供了抽取Style样式的方式, 可能是藏的太深了, 很少人用 光标放在控件内: 右键...如果你用的很多, 也可以为它设置快捷键: 打开Android Studio设置页面, 在Keymap中搜索extract, Style就是了, 然后右键单击Style 为它添加快捷键 ?...然后就快捷键, 愉快的玩耍了 补充知识:Android Studio Button 美化 改变按钮Button控件的边角、填充颜色、边框颜色。...<shape xmlns:android="http://schemas.android.com/apk/res/android" <corners android:bottomLeftRadius...: android:background=”@drawable/btn_all_shape” 以上这篇Android Studio自动提取控件Style样式教程就是小编分享给大家的全部内容了,希望能给大家一个参考

    1.1K20

    Android studio 插件之 GsonFormat (自动生成javabean)

    今天给大家推荐一个插件 GsonFormat  这个插件就是可以让我们直接将服务端返回的json转化为实体类,Android studio和idea都有, eclipse我没有试过。...操作步骤 第一步  下载插件 下载插件的过程我前面有一篇博客已经有详细步骤  Android Studio插件之sexy editor(设置AS背景) 大家 只需要将那篇博客中介绍的插件名称换成GsonFormat...第二步  自动生成bean 下面我们介绍怎么通过这个插件将服务端返回的json自动生成javabean 首先  我们要建一个空的java类,然后 在空白出点击鼠标右键  选择 Generate......贴上json字符串和自动生成出的bean代码. json字符串 {"retval":"ok","reterr":"","retinfo":{"count":2,"groups":[{"groupid":

    64520

    Android应用开发】Android Studio 简介 (Android Studio Overview)

    Intelij IDEA 环境简介 Android Studio 来源 : Android Studio 是 Intelij IDEA 的免费版本 + Android SDK 集成的; -- Intelij...模块可以使用 Project 级别的 SDK, 也可以使用 Moudle 级别特定的 SDK; (4) SDK 中得各种路径 SDK 路径 : 在 Intelij IDEA 中定义一个 SDK 时, IDE 会自动寻找...Android Studio 工程目录结构 1....-- 使用方式 : 该编译系统 既可以从 Android Studio 菜单中运行工具,  也可以是从命令行运行的独立的工具; 编译系统功能 : 灵活的 Android 编译系统使你能够达到以下列出的功能不用修改工程的核心文件...扩展模板 和 支持要素 扩展模板 : Android Studio 支持 Google 服务的新模板, 扩展可用的设备类型; 3.

    2.2K41

    android studio接口调用_android studio jdk版本

    Android 做jni的时候 需要根据native java类生成对应的.h头文件,然后根据.h头文件写cpp文件。...在Android studio 中可以添加自定义工具,将javah指令添加进去 首先我们看下javah的指令格式 由此指令我们知道怎么使用javah指令 例如有java文件 D:\project\Test...intermediates\javac\debug\classes\ -jni -d D:\project\Test\app\src\main\cpp com.example.test 知道指令后,将这个指令添加到android...studio File – Settings – 打开Settings Name: javah 显示的名称 Description: javah 指令详情 Program: javah 指令的路径...这里显示的路径信息是根据你android studio 工程当前打开什么文件,根据这文件展示路径信息的,选择对应路径信息,填入Arguments 里就行 working directory: 指令在哪个路径下执行

    1.5K10

    解决Android Studio 代码自动提示突然失效的问题

    昨天代码写的好好的,今天一打开Android Studio 开始写代码,居然没有代码自动提示了,我他妈也是醉了,学个安卓开发真是心累,各种幺蛾子。...出现原因: 开启了省电模式,导致代码自动提示失效了。如下图: ? 解决办法: 关闭省电模式,点击Power Save Mode 那一栏,把勾去掉即可。如下图: ?...补充知识:一步解决android studio中编写xml代码或者Java代码时提示功能失效! 只需简单一步操作: 关闭android studio。...重新用android studio打开项目即可。 以上这篇解决Android Studio 代码自动提示突然失效的问题就是小编分享给大家的全部内容了,希望能给大家一个参考。

    3.6K41

    Android Studio自动排版的两种实现方式

    Android Studio这样的集成开发环境虽然代码自动化程度很高,但是自动化程度高导致人的自主性就下降了,而且总是依赖编辑器的功能也会搞得代码排版很别扭。...最难受的是你在Android Studio中编写界面.xml文件的时候,代码自动化程度不高,缩进什么的都不自动,改个代码都能搞得排版一塌糊涂。...(2)还有一个不用记快捷键的好办法:就是先全选所有代码,ctrl+x先剪切,然后ctrl+v粘贴,现在看你的代码是不是非常舒服,也就是粘贴的时候,android studio已经帮你排版好了,不用再劳烦你了...补充知识:android studio 3.5 ctrl alt l 自动排版导致布局紊乱处理方法 背景 升级AndroidStudio到了当前最新的版本3.5后自动排版发现怎么布局出问题了 问题描述...以上这篇Android Studio自动排版的两种实现方式就是小编分享给大家的全部内容了,希望能给大家一个参考。

    1.6K20
    领券